The 2024 season was the 17th season for the Indian Premier League franchise kkr }}. They were one of the ten teams competed in the 2024 Indian Premier League. They finished at the 7th place in previous season's League stage.[1]
Ahead of the 2024 season, Shreyas Iyer returned as the captain after missing out the 2023 season due to back injury.[2] [3] After their 9th win on 11 May 2024, Kolkata became the first team to be qualified for the Playoffs.[4] [5] After their abandoned match on 13 May 2024, Kolkata qualifed for the Qualifier 1.[6] [7] They finished the League stage at the 1st place with 9 wins and 3 losses, garnering 20 points and seeding their place in the Qualifier 1.
After defeating Sunrisers Hyderabad in the Qualifier 1 played on 21st May at Ahmedabad, Kolkata became the first team to advance to the 2024 final for the 4th time.[8] [9] After defeating Sunrisers Hyderabad in the final played on 26th May at Chennai, Kolkata won their 3rd IPL title after 2012 and 2014.[10] [11]
Sunil Narine was named as the "Ultimate Fantasy player of the season" and was awarded with ₹10 lakh (US$13,000) cash prize along with a trophy. Ramandeep Singh was named as the "Catch of the season" and was awarded with ₹10 lakh (US$13,000) cash prize along with a trophy. Sunil Narine was also the "Most Valuable Player of the season" (450 points)[12] and was awarded with ₹10 lakh (US$13,000) cash prize along with a trophy.[13]
